Kersey Way SE to close for area improvements

Kersey Way Southeast from Oravetz Road Southeast to 2nd Street East, including the intersection at 53rd Street Southeast and Kersey Way Southeast, will be closed to through traffic beginning Monday, July 7 at 7 a.m.

It is anticipated that the intersection of 53rd Street Southeast will be reopened to allow southbound traffic on to Kersey Way on July 25 at 7 p.m.

The Kersey Way Road closure north of 53rd Street Southeast is expected to continue until Aug. 9 at 7 p.m.

The developer will be constructing water, sanitary sewer and storm drainage lines along with the required surface improvements.

Those upgrades include a significant change to the road grade of Kersey Way Southeast along with curb and gutter, sidewalk, asphalt pavement, street lighting and the addition of a traffic signal at 53rd Street Southeast.

The required improvements will provide the necessary capacity for the planned residential developments in the area.
